    Hmong Today (Xov-Xwm Hmoob) is an American nationwide newspaper documenting the news and culture of the Hmong American community. [1] It is published biweekly and based in St. Paul, Minnesota. [2] The publisher of the newspaper is Sang Moua [3] and the president of the company is Sy Vang. [4]
